THEATRE PROGRAMMES

Theatre Royal: “Virtue—ln Danger.’’ Savoy: “Daddy Long Legs.” Mayfair: “The Last Time I Saw Paris.” Avon: “The Country Girl.” State: “Bedevilled.” Majestic: “One Good Turn.” Regent: “Dragnet.” Crystal Palace: “The Vicious Years.”

Tivoli: “Prince of Pirates.” Plaza: “The 5000 Fingers of Dr. T.” St. James’: “Sidewalks of London.” Rex: “The Wooden Horse.” Metro: “Treasure of Sierra Madre” find “The Maenetic Monster.” Century: “The Blue Gardenia.” Embassy: “Naked Alibi” and “Four Guns to the Border.”
